Transaction 7be6a309fcc26afb5949cb09183000942ea003203bbfe1183248cf124d4e47e1
1 Input
2 Outputs
- 7be6a309fcc26afb5949cb09183000942ea003203bbfe1183248cf124d4e47e1:0
- 7be6a309fcc26afb5949cb09183000942ea003203bbfe1183248cf124d4e47e1:1
value 183038763
address mqwgkTVfUiF6QBCyYspQNLtoW4dAaPj6Sw
value 990000
address mmuCP67ydfTvTNm28EXGTn2H6R3VhhsczN